CIMIC Group has announced that Leighton Asia has been selected by NLEX Corporation, a subsidiary of Metro Pacific Tollways Corporation (MPTC), to construct the North Luzon Expressway (NLEX) Harbour Link Segment 10 – R10 Exit Ramp project in the Philippines. Revenue to Leighton Asia, which is part of CIMIC Group construction company CPB Contractors, will be approximately AUD140 million (US$102.6 million).
Construction works include a 2.6km dual, elevated tollway to link the existing NLEX Segment 10 Road to the R10 Road and provide a continuation of Harbour Link, as well as various ramps, roadworks, electrical and mechanical works and landscaping. Advanced works have commenced and the project is scheduled to be completed in late 2019.
Leighton Asia’s Philippines business is also working with MPTC subsidiary MPCALA Holdings Inc. to build the 28km, four-lane Cavite-Laguna Expressway.
